Fab Fragment Therapy (Digibind)
- Indications
- Severe rhythm disturbances refractory to conventional therapy
- End-organ dysfunction
- Hyperkalemia >5 after acute overdose
- Pacemaker (may mask cardiac dysrhythmia)
- Consider for:
- Dig level > 10 in acute ingestion
- Dig level > 4 in chronic ingestion
- If adult acutely ingests > 10mg
- If child acutely ingests > 4mg
- Side effects
- Allergic reaction
- Withdrawal of dig effect:
- CHF, a fib w/ RVR
- Hypokalemia
- Initial response time ~ 20min, peak effect ~ 90min
How To Use
- Neither amount ingested nor digoxin level are known:
- Adult dose
- 10 vials over 30 min
- Peds dose
- 5 vials over 30 min
- Repeat dose if clinical response is inadequate
- Adult dose
- Amount ingested is known but digoxin level is unknown
- Calculate total body load (TBL)
- TBL = dose (in mg) ingested
- Calculate number of vials needed
- Number of vials = TBL X 2 (round up to nearest whole number)
- Steady state digoxin level is known
- Number of vials = (dig level(in ng/mL) X pt wt) / 100
- Chronic toxicity without severe signs
- Give half the recommended dose
- Otherwise may unmask the condition for which the pt is taking digoxin
- Cardiac Arrest
- 20 vials administered undiluted by IV bolus
